Torque Metals has confirmed a significant 240-metre westward extension of high-grade gold mineralisation at its Paris Gold Project in Western Australia, highlighted by a standout 5m intercept grading 27.93 g/t gold. This breakthrough validates their down hole electromagnetics exploration strategy and sets the stage for further resource growth.

Centaurus Metals has reported significant new high-grade copper-gold mineralisation at its Boi Novo Project in Brazil, including a newly discovered shallow zone at Nelore East with assays up to 11.5m at 2.84% copper and 0.90g/t gold. Drilling at Nelore West confirms continuity of mineralised breccia pipes, expanding the project's potential.
